This one year fullt-time Higher National Diploma (HND) in Aeronautical Engineering is designed for those looking to develop advanced knowledge and specialist skills in aerospace engineering while continuing in employment.\
\
Building on level 4 study, the course focuses on aircraft systems, propulsion and advanced aerospace technologies, preparing you for higher-level roles within the industry or progression to a degree.\
\
Throughout the course, you will apply your learning through project-based work and industry-relevant activities, developing the skills required for progression into higher-level roles or further study within the aerospace sector.\
\
This flexible programme supports career development in the aerospace and aviation sectors.

Standard entry to this course requires a minimum of 32 UCAS points from a recognised level 3 qualification in a related subject (eg. T-Level, BTEC National, Access to Higher Education, or A-levels or equivalent) or a higher level qualification in an unrelated subject area with a significant mathematical content. You are expected to hold GCSE English and maths at grade 4 or equivalent. We welcome applicants who do not match standard entry requirements but who can demonstrate the ability to study this subject at university level and who can evidence relevant experience.
